    I wrote this a few days ago on the Steve Evans' thread:

    It's not that the table lies but that it deceives. Just over a quarter of games played, only about half the teams played, no winter weather, clubs still sorting out their best squads and overcoming close season mistakes, enthusiasm particularly of newly promoted clubs yet to wane, match fitness levels improving, luck yet to even out.

    Personally I'd be happier being Luton than Notts at the moment. But - Nolan is learning all the time and he seems keen to continue to learn, he seems very grounded and no-one can deny that 29 points on the board at this stage is awesome - 21 from safety - a point a game will leave us with a respectable 62 points. But I recall similar being said about Derry in 2014/15 when we were riding high at the end of October.

    So are we THE TOP side in league 2? Probably not. Are we A TOP side in league 2 - seems as if we are getting there. Ask me again when all 46 games have been played
    My main worry from tonight is that it seemed we still lumped the ball forward when we had no target men and that seemed to give Crewe (a team we usually beat) confidence.
